人類對來自海洋的食物、能源、交通、娛樂和其他服務的需求正在迅速增加,以海洋永續為出發的藍色經濟發展已成為世界各國重視的發展方向並快速增長。雖然海洋資源促進了增長和財富,但也受到人為、氣候變遷等許多因素面臨許多挑戰。人類對海洋仍有許多未知領域需要探索,知識的生產傳播是藍色經濟研究發展必要的核心基礎。本研究以藍色經濟為研究主題進行書目計量分析,以理解目前國際上研發成果的知識累積以及網路分布。本研究利用Web of Science資料庫檢索2012至2021年10年期間之藍色經濟文獻特性。結果顯示,本研究發現藍色經濟在2017年後,逐漸成為歐美國家研究的重要領域,在相關研究發表量上有顯著的提升。在學科分布上,藍色經濟的相關領域相當多元,包括環境科學、環境研究、海洋與淡水生物學、國際關係、綠色永續科技、以及地理、生物、物理、工程等領域。本研究透過關鍵字分析發現藍色經濟與管理、漁業、水產養殖、以及永續等五個關鍵字的研究產出最多。本研究結果能對我國藍色經濟產業研發應投入方向有所啟發,亦探究國際上的科研發展,以順應國際趨勢作為我國推動藍色經濟研究與產業發展的需要,據以提供決策參考依據。
Human demand for food, energy, transportation, recreation, and other services from the ocean is increasing rapidly, and the blue economy is growing at an unprecedented rate. Marine resources have contributed to growth and wealth, but they are threatened by several factors, including anthropogenic and climate change factors. Knowledge production and dissemination are essential for the advancement of research on the blue economy research. Focusing on the blue economy as the research theme, we performed a bibliometric analysis to understand the current accumulation of knowledge and the distribution of research and development results. We used the Web of Science database to search for studies for the period from 2012 to 2021. The results revealed that the blue economy has gradually become a key research field in European and American countries since 2017 and that the number of relevant publications has increased significantly during this period. Fields related to the blue economy are diverse, including environmental science, environmental studies, marine and freshwater biology, international relations, green and sustainable technology, geography, biology, physics, and engineering. The five most common keywords in the field are as follows: blue economy, management, fisheries, aquaculture, and sustainability. The future sustainable development of the blue economy will depend on governance, ecological, economic, policy, and technological factors. Our findings can inform the direction of investment in research on and the development of the blue economy. Our findings also contribute to the international promotion of blue economy research and industry development and provide a reference for decision-makers in Taiwan.
